#include "linker_debug.h"
#include <unistd.h>
#include <android-base/strings.h>
LinkerDebugConfig g_linker_debug_config;
void init_LD_DEBUG(const std::string& value) {
if (value.empty()) return ;
std::vector<std::string> options = android::base::Split(value, "," );
for (const auto & o : options) {
if (o == "calls" ) g_linker_debug_config.calls = true ;
else if (o == "cfi" ) g_linker_debug_config.cfi = true ;
else if (o == "dynamic" ) g_linker_debug_config.dynamic = true ;
else if (o == "lookup" ) g_linker_debug_config.lookup = true ;
else if (o == "props" ) g_linker_debug_config.props = true ;
else if (o == "reloc" ) g_linker_debug_config.reloc = true ;
else if (o == "statistics" ) g_linker_debug_config.statistics = true ;
else if (o == "timing" ) g_linker_debug_config.timing = true ;
else if (o == "all" ) {
g_linker_debug_config.calls = true ;
g_linker_debug_config.cfi = true ;
g_linker_debug_config.dynamic = true ;
g_linker_debug_config.lookup = true ;
g_linker_debug_config.props = true ;
g_linker_debug_config.reloc = true ;
g_linker_debug_config.statistics = true ;
g_linker_debug_config.timing = true ;
} else {
__linker_error("$LD_DEBUG is a comma-separated list of:\n"
"\n"
" calls ctors/dtors/ifuncs\n"
" cfi control flow integrity messages\n"
" dynamic dynamic section processing\n"
" lookup symbol lookup\n"
" props ELF property processing\n"
" reloc relocation resolution\n"
" statistics relocation statistics\n"
" timing timing information\n"
"\n"
"or 'all' for all of the above.\n" );
}
}
if (g_linker_debug_config.calls || g_linker_debug_config.cfi ||
g_linker_debug_config.dynamic || g_linker_debug_config.lookup ||
g_linker_debug_config.props || g_linker_debug_config.reloc ||
g_linker_debug_config.statistics || g_linker_debug_config.timing) {
g_linker_debug_config.any = true ;
}
}
static void linker_log_va_list(int prio, const char * fmt, va_list ap) {
va_list ap2;
va_copy(ap2, ap);
async_safe_format_log_va_list(prio, "linker" , fmt, ap2);
va_end(ap2);
async_safe_format_fd_va_list(STDERR_FILENO, fmt, ap);
write(STDERR_FILENO, "\n" , 1 );
}
void __linker_log(int prio, const char * fmt, ...) {
va_list ap;
va_start(ap, fmt);
linker_log_va_list(prio, fmt, ap);
va_end(ap);
}
void __linker_error(const char * fmt, ...) {
va_list ap;
va_start(ap, fmt);
linker_log_va_list(ANDROID_LOG_FATAL, fmt, ap);
va_end(ap);
_exit (EXIT_FAILURE);
}
